Insecurity: Amid Alleged St. Peter’s Rukubi Students Abduction, Nasarawa Govt. Urges Public Against Fake News

LAFIA   –   FOLLOWING the alleged kidnapping of some students of St Peter’s Academy Rukubi in Doma local government area of the state; the Nasarawa State government has warned against unverified reports capable of breaching the prevailing relative peace in the state.

The warning was contained in a statement signed by Chief Press Secretary to governor Abdullahi Sule, Mr. Ibrahim Addra and available to newsmen in Lafia the state capital.

The statement said that the warning became an imperative following the completely false report of an alleged kidnapping of students in Doma LGA of the state.

The statement read” Reports from local authorities, the principal of the purported school and community members indicated no such incidence occurred in the area.

“The Nasarawa State Police Command through its Public Relations Officer, PRO in particular has issued a statement categorically debunking this falsehood,” the statement read.

The statement further enjoined the residents to disregard this false alarm, and remain law abiding as Government remain unwavering in its commitment to the security of lives and property in the state.
